Evolution: Bringing a Pokemon to its next evolutionary step demands only Candy, no Stardust. But you might need to collect a fairly great deal of it. For example, to convert Magikarp---a worthless fish---into its badass dragon successor Gyarados, you will need a whopping 400 Magikarp Candy.
Tempt out Pokemon: The items Incense and Tempt Module draw Pokemon out from hiding. The Lure Module is more cogent and can be attached to a specific place for a span. Power Ups: A Power Up improves a Pokemon's CP and HP. To perform a Power Up, you need one thing that is pretty clear-cut and another thing that's a bit more complex. The square thing is Stardust, which you automatically accumulate any time you catch a Pokemon, and will desire a certain amount of for each Power Up. The more complex thing is Candy, which comes in another kind for each evolutionary Pokemon line. What do we mean by "each evolutionary Pokemon line?" For example, even though Pidgey evolves into Pidgeotto, both only demand Pidgey Candy for Power Ups.

Stats. CP, or Battle Points, is definitely the most significant of a Pokemon's stats and ascertains how much damage it deals in battle. There's also the Hit Points (HP) stat, which is the amount of damage a Pokemon can take, but HP monitors closely to CP, and the two upgrade simultaneously, so it is good to focus only on CP.
Pokemon in Do Not have amounts and experience points like they do in other Pokemon games, but they can still be made stronger with your help.
Catch them all: In Pokemon Go, amount is essential. You might not want an entire batch of Zubats, but there is strength in numbers---or more particularly Stardust and Candy. When you get Pokemon, you will receive both things, which are used, respectively, to power up and evolve Pokemon. You get about 5 to 10 pieces of Candy when you catch the first of a species and then 3 to 5 for subsequent catches.

Types are an important theory in all Pokemon games, and Go is no exception. Each Pokemon and each move have a kind. Go appears to use the sixth-generation Pokemon type system, which comprises 18 kinds, for example clear things like "Water," "Fire," and "Lightning," as well as unusual stuff like "Dark" and "Fairy." Each kind is powerful against a few other kinds, and immune to others. For instance, Water is incredibly powerful against Fire, but Grass is resistant to Water, while Grass is vulnerable to Fire, et cetera. The permutations can get a bit weird---"Bug," for example, is highly effective against "Psychic," and "Dragon" has no effect whatsoever on "Fairy."
Pokedex: The Pokedex, which you access by tapping the Pokball on the main display, keeps track of your Pokemon and reveals how many species you have yet to strike. For species of Pokemon you've seen and caught, the Pokedex will reveal detailed information, including its weight, height, kind, and evolutionary chain (e.g., Charmander evolves into Charmeleon, which evolves into Charizard).

Evolving gives a Pokemon a enormous CP boost, and gives your player an excellent amount of expertise. There is one thing to be careful of when evolving: Your Pokemon's moves will change later. So if you've got a highly rare Pokemon with your favored move, it might be worth leaving it as is until you can catch another one.
